Does movement of any kind affect the product’s ability to provide an accurate reading?

Yes, movement of any kind can lead the device to display inaccurate readings. It is important to use the device as specified in the application guide, product documentation, troubleshoot guide and quick start guides.

 

What are normal oxygen saturation levels?

The normal reading for blood oxygen is typically in the 95-100 range. However, there are certain conditions where this may not apply. Your doctor will be in the best position to advice where your readings should be.

 

Can I check my readings while I am exercising?

Any movement can cause the device to reset its readings. If you are in the middle of exercising, we advise to take readings during resting phases while the body is not mobile. If you have finished, wait 10-15 minutes before taking a reading.

 

What is the real accuracy deviation of this Zacurate Oximeter and what does it mean?

The pulse oximeter has an accuracy level of +/-2%. This means that the item’s blood oxygen saturation readings are a close or exact correct measurement within a standard deviation of +/-2%
